Arduino软件驱动智能硬件开发与物联网项目实战解析的核心价值,在于其将复杂的硬件编程简化为可视化的操作流程。该平台通过集成开发环境(IDE)提供代码编写、调试和上传功能,即使是零基础用户也能快速完成传感器连接、数据采集等基础操作。其开源特性吸引了全球开发者共享超过2000个扩展库,涵盖灯光控制、温湿度监测等物联网常见场景。
在物联网项目实战中,这套工具的优势尤为显著。开发者可通过预设的通信协议(如Wi-Fi、蓝牙)直接连接云端平台,实现设备远程监控。例如用户仅需数行代码就能搭建一个实时上传环境数据的智能气象站,这种低门槛的开发模式让Arduino软件驱动智能硬件开发与物联网项目实战解析成为教育领域和创客社群的标配工具。
获取Arduino软件驱动智能硬件开发与物联网项目实战解析工具链,需通过官网(www.arduino.cc)确保安装包安全性。网站提供Windows、macOS、Linux多平台版本,下载时应注意选择对应操作系统的安装包。对于国内用户,建议使用迅雷等下载工具加速资源获取,部分高校镜像站点也提供稳定的本地化下载服务。
安装过程中需特别注意驱动程序的完整加载。Windows用户在首次连接开发板时,系统可能提示缺少CH340芯片驱动,此时需要手动安装官网提供的驱动程序包。安装完成后,建议通过「示例程序」菜单运行Blink测试代码,观察板载LED是否规律闪烁,以此验证软件环境配置是否成功。
在实际操作层面,Arduino软件驱动智能硬件开发与物联网项目实战解析展现出极佳的用户友好性。其界面左侧的代码自动补全功能可减少90%的拼写错误,右侧的串口监视器能实时显示传感器数据流。测试中将温湿度模块接入开发板后,系统在5秒内即完成数据解析并生成可视化图表,响应速度达到工业级标准。
项目资源库的丰富程度超出预期。平台内置的Project Hub收录了3000余个经过验证的物联网方案,从智能家居控制系统到农业大棚监测网络应有尽有。特别值得一提的是每个案例都配备物料清单和3D打印文件,用户可完全复现项目成果。这种开箱即用的特性大幅降低了物联网开发的技术门槛。
使用Arduino软件驱动智能硬件开发与物联网项目实战解析时,设备联网安全需格外重视。建议为每个物联网节点设置独立密钥,避免使用默认的admin/admin登录凭证。在测试阶段可启用软件内置的防火墙模拟功能,该系统能自动拦截异常数据包并生成安全报告,有效预防70%以上的网络攻击行为。
物理层面的防护同样关键。当开发板通过USB连接电脑时,建议加装电流保护模块防止短路事故。对于涉及220V强电控制的项目,务必使用光耦隔离器确保低压控制电路与执行电路完全分离。平台提供的SafeMode启动选项可在系统异常时保留调试日志,这对排查硬件兼容性问题具有重要价值。
通过上述四个维度的系统解析可以看出,Arduino软件驱动智能硬件开发与物联网项目实战解析不仅是一套开发工具,更是连接创意与现实的桥梁。其持续迭代的生态体系正在推动全球物联网应用进入平民化开发时代,为智慧城市、工业4.0等重大战略提供底层技术支撑。无论是教育机构还是企业研发部门,掌握这套工具都将获得显著的创新加速度。